WebC. olorectal cancer (CRC) is a common disease, diagnosed in nearly 1.4 million people worldwide annually.1 In the United States, there are nearly 133,000 new diagnoses each year.2 Approximately one-third of patients with CRC will develop metastatic disease. In most of these patients, the disease relapses and becomes refractory. The Recurrent and Refractory Cancer Treatment Program is dedicated to working with patients whose cancers have … can food allergies cause muscle achesWebBackground: Standard treatment for high-risk non-muscle-invasive bladder cancer is transurethral resection of bladder tumour followed by intravesical BCG immunotherapy. However, despite high initial responses rates, up to 50% of patients have recurrence or become BCG-unresponsive.
